Frank Palombo was a New York City Firefighter from Ladder 105 in Brooklyn. His memorial service was held Saturday, 10.20.01 at St. Colomba's on West 25 Street in Chelsea. Frank left a wife and ten children. Frank gave his life at the World Trade Center saving civilians. Frank was in or near the Marriott Hotel when the first tower collapsed. "The worst part of this for me is the children," Mayor Giuliani said at the memorial service, and then turning to the 10 children added: "Nobody can take your daddy away from you, you know that you are the son and daughter of a great man, a hero, a fallen warrior."
